Worcester's Business Ecosystem and Express Delivery Demand
Worcester is home to over 8,400 active companies, spanning manufacturing, healthcare, professional services, and retail. Of these, 139 firms operate in road freight logistics alone, alongside 25 specialist courier and postal service providers — a competitive marketplace that rewards speed and reliability equally. The city's consulting sector is equally robust, with 382 management consultancy firms operating across the WR postcode area, many of which depend on rapid document delivery to clients across the UK and beyond.
Healthcare demand is particularly strong. Worcester supports 26 hospital activities, 104 medical practices, 56 residential care homes, and 67 social work providers — representing a combined ecosystem of 306 CQC-regulated providers across the city. These organisations routinely require urgent delivery of patient records, diagnostic samples, medical supplies, and equipment. Residential care homes and social work services depend on same-day courier runs for critical documentation and care supplies. E-commerce retailers — 198 firms selling via internet channels — also fuel demand; their next-day and same-day promises are only credible if logistics partners deliver consistently. Manufacturing and engineering operations (15 automotive manufacturers, 5 electronics firms, 2 machinery specialists) need urgent spare parts to avoid production stoppages. All of these sectors create daily express delivery demand that Royal Mail and standard parcel services simply cannot satisfy within contractual windows.

What I've Learned from Running Express Delivery Across Worcester
I've been managing express runs into and out of Worcester for over a decade now, and one scenario stands out. A manufacturing firm on the Worcester Business Park needed an urgent batch of components — machined parts for an aerospace subcontractor — delivered to a warehouse near Junction 6 on the M5, close to Redditch. The collection was booked at 2:45pm on a Friday. Weather forecasts flagged heavy rain and congestion reports for the A44 corridor by 4pm. We collected at 2:52pm, assessed the route conditions in real-time, and routed via the M42 and M5 approach roads instead. Delivery was confirmed by 4:38pm — well ahead of the customer's 5pm cutoff for weekend processing. That's when I realised: in express delivery, it's not just speed off the booking sheet that matters. It's route intelligence, real-time decision-making, and driver experience of the local motorway network. Worcester's geographic position — between the M5, M42, and A44 — makes routing flexibility essential. That's why our drivers know these roads intimately, and why we invest in live traffic feeds and contingency routes. The parcel arrived safely. The customer met their commitment to the next stage of supply. And we learned that express delivery reliability in Worcester depends on anticipating congestion, not just reacting to it.

Express Delivery vs. Standard Parcel Services
Royal Mail and general parcel carriers offer valuable services, but they're not designed for same-day or next-morning critical deadlines. Royal Mail's Universal Service Obligation (as defined under the Postal Services Act 2000) guarantees next-working-day delivery across the UK, but collections are scheduled at their convenience, not yours. Parcel carriers like Yodel, DPD, and Hermes operate economies of scale — which is cost-effective for volume shipments — but they consolidate parcels into regional hubs, adding time and handoff risk.
Express delivery is different. Your parcel is collected within the hour, routed directly to the recipient (or your nearest dispatch point), and tracked continuously. There's no consolidation delay, no shared vehicle, no overnight depot hold. For urgent stock replenishment, emergency parts delivery, or client deadlines, the speed difference is critical.
